[SCM] libxml-semanticdiff-perl Debian packaging branch, master, updated. debian/1.00.00-1-15-g9cd6266

Jonas Smedegaard dr at jones.dk
Mon Jul 1 10:25:00 UTC 2013


The following commit has been merged in the master branch:
commit cf860dec631cbb5e5c78b52b448fbf3681d6033b
Author: Jonas Smedegaard <dr at jones.dk>
Date:   Mon Jul 1 12:17:53 2013 +0200

    Tidy rules file: Tighten package-specific CDBS variables.

diff --git a/debian/rules b/debian/rules
index da2d2ab..3d9cc26 100755
--- a/debian/rules
+++ b/debian/rules
@@ -21,18 +21,21 @@ include /usr/share/cdbs/1/rules/utils.mk
 include /usr/share/cdbs/1/class/perl-build.mk
 include /usr/share/cdbs/1/rules/debhelper.mk
 
+pkg = $(DEB_SOURCE_PACKAGE)
+
 DEB_UPSTREAM_PACKAGE = XML-SemanticDiff
 #DEB_UPSTREAM_URL = http://www.cpan.org/modules/by-module/XML
 DEB_UPSTREAM_URL = http://search.cpan.org/CPAN/authors/id/S/SH/SHLOMIF
 DEB_UPSTREAM_TARBALL_BASENAME_MANGLE = s/(\d)\.(\d{2})\.(\d{2})/$$1.$$2$$3/
 DEB_UPSTREAM_TARBALL_MD5 = 013a0f5d4e5347deda12e1e90e3ab9e7
 
-# Needed both by upstream build process and at runtime
-common-depends = libxml-parser-perl
-CDBS_BUILD_DEPENDS += , $(common-depends)
-CDBS_DEPENDS = $(common-depends)
+# Needed by upstream build and (always) at runtime
+deps = libxml-parser-perl
 
 # Needed by upstream tests
-CDBS_BUILD_DEPENDS += , libtest-pod-perl, libtest-pod-coverage-perl
+deps-test = libtest-pod-perl, libtest-pod-coverage-perl
+
+CDBS_BUILD_DEPENDS +=, $(deps), $(deps-test)
+CDBS_DEPENDS_$(pkg) = $(deps)
 
-DEB_INSTALL_EXAMPLES_ALL = eg/*
+DEB_INSTALL_EXAMPLES_$(pkg) = eg/*

-- 
libxml-semanticdiff-perl Debian packaging



More information about the Pkg-perl-cvs-commits mailing list